Frequently Asked Questions

How do I install Red Dead Redemption (PC) on my computer?

Download the game from your preferred platform, then follow the on-screen installation instructions to complete setup.

Is my PC compatible with Red Dead Redemption's launch features?

Ensure your PC meets the minimum system requirements listed on the official site; features like 4K or HDR need supported hardware.

Can I access multiplayer mode in Red Dead Redemption on PC?

No, this version includes only the single-player experience; multiplayer is not available for PC in this edition.

How can I customize the game's graphics settings for better performance?

Open Settings > Graphics in the game menu to adjust resolution, draw distances, shadow quality, HDR, and more for optimal performance.

Does the PC version support ultrawide or multi-monitor setups?

Yes, the game supports Ultrawide (21:9) and Super Ultrawide (32:9) displays; set these options in game graphics settings.

Are there any subscription services necessary to play Red Dead Redemption on PC?

No, the game requires a one-time purchase; no ongoing subscriptions are needed unless using a specific platform like Xbox Game Pass.

Is there an option to purchase additional content or DLC for this game?

This version includes the complete single-player experience and bonus content from the Game of the Year Edition; additional DLC is not included.
